The book covers a wide array of essential topics that form the backbone of abstract algebra, including induction, binomial coefficients, and greatest common divisors. These foundational concepts are not only critical for further studies in mathematics but also equip me with the skills to approach complex problems logically and systematically. The inclusion of the Fundamental Theorem of Arithmetic is particularly noteworthy as it solidifies my understanding of how numbers behave in different contexts, laying the groundwork for more advanced theories.

One of the standout features of this book is its exploration of congruences and set theory. Understanding these concepts is crucial for anyone pursuing mathematics, as they are the building blocks of number theory and algebraic structures. The author does an exceptional job of explaining these ideas clearly, making them accessible even to those who may be encountering them for the first time. Moreover, the treatment of permutations, groups, and subgroups, including Lagrange’s Theorem, is a highlight that demonstrates the interconnectedness of various mathematical concepts.

The sections on homomorphisms, quotient groups, and group actions provide a deep insight into the structure of algebraic systems. I appreciate how the author presents these topics with clarity and rigor, ensuring that I grasp their significance and applications. The treatment of vector spaces, linear transformations, and determinants further enhances my understanding of linear algebra, a crucial area that intersects with abstract algebra. The exploration of canonical forms and the classical formulas used in various mathematical proofs makes this book not only informative but also a practical guide for problem-solving.

Furthermore, the discussions on finite fields, unique factorization, and Noetherian rings reveal the depth and breadth of abstract algebra. The author’s insights into prime ideals and maximal ideals are particularly enlightening, as they pave the way for further exploration in algebraic geometry and number theory.
